Go to a twilight cultist camp in Silithus. Kill all the cultists, and turn in the encrypted twilight texts they drop for rep. Collect the twilight armor and use the set to summon abyssal templars at the wind stones, turn in the Abyssal Crests they drop for more rep. Buy encrypted twilight texts, abyssal crests, abyssal signets, abyssal scepters from the AH to turn in. Instead, try to sneak all the way into the enemy's base (Dun Baldar or Frostwolf Keep) to assault one of those two towers right at the start. Generally, no one will try stopping you, and very few people actually rush for those towers in the beginning. After that, go for a graveyard assault. If you're fast enough, you can probably get either the one right in the base (the relief hut or the aid station), or the one directly outside of it (Frostwolf or Stormpike). After you get the assaults out of the way, you can then just head to the middle and try to defend whatever seems the easiest. People rarely defend graveyards contested graveyards, so defending one of those isn't usually hard (Stonehearth or Iceblood are usually the easiest ones to defend). Towers, on the other hand, can be difficult. They usually have a couple of defenders, at least, so retaking them on your own isn't always viable. And, yeah, if you see an opportunity to get your Field of Strife kill while you're going around defending, don't hesitate to take it.
